I FOUND this unfinished top at my local thrift store for a dollar. It's about as bad as they come. All sorts of blended fabrics, seams don't line up, doesn't lay flat, puckers to no end. It is truly the worst thing I've ever seen.

And I bought it anyway!

Any ideas on how I might jazz it up if and when I dare try and finish it?

Looks to be made around the 70's. Pictures attached.

Wow, you aren't kidding that one is pretty, er, um, uh, well someone gave it their best shot. I dunno if you will be able to quilt it flat or not. But you can always accentuate the eccentricity of it and just go at it warts and all and not worry if you get tucks, puckers etc in the quilting. I will give the piecer credit on the turquoise border. Looks like they tried mitering the corners!

You might put some sort of turquoise or pink in a border that would pull those colors out from the center....if you don't decide to do what some of the others have suggested.

Also, I think if you wash it and it shrinks somewhat maybe you can starch and iron it and it will behave better. Let us see what you do.
